#607b5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#607b5e is composed of 37.6% red, 48.2%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.6% yellow and 51.8% black. It has a hue angle of 115.9 degrees, a saturation of 13.4% and a lightness of 42.5%. #607b5e color hex could be obtained by blending #c0f6bc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#607b5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f5f7f5 is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#607b5e is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#707070 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#6d726c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#827a63 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#8c7669 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#6e7d86 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#767a61 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#7c7865 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#697c77 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
